Italy’s Tuscany region is celebrated worldwide for its exceptional wines, and the area of Montalcino stands out as one of its crowning jewels. Casanova di Neri, founded in 1971 by Giovanni Neri, remains a family-run estate now led by his son, Giacomo Neri. The winery has earned international acclaim for its relentless pursuit of quality, with vineyards carefully sited across Montalcino’s most prized terroirs. This commitment to excellence has positioned Casanova di Neri among the modern icons of Brunello production. Wine Description This Brunello di Montalcino 2020 is crafted exclusively from Sangiovese, known locally as Brunello. It reveals a deep ruby hue with garnet reflections, offering an elegant nose layered with ripe red cherry, wild strawberry, dried rose petals, and subtle notes of spice and tobacco. On the palate, the wine is full-bodied yet remarkably graceful, displaying finely woven tannins and vibrant acidity that sustain flavours of crushed raspberry, black tea, and hints of earthy undergrowth. The finish is long and polished, lingering with notes of minerality and sweet herbs. Accolades Wine Spectator – 95 points. Vinous – 94 points. James Suckling – 96 points. Food Pairing Enjoy this Brunello with dishes that complement its layered complexity and structure. Braised veal shank, roasted game birds, or a rich mushroom risotto will beautifully echo its earthy undertones. Aged Pecorino or Parmigiano also pair exquisitely, highlighting the wine’s depth and finesse. Together, they create an unforgettable dining experience.
